Job Description – Business Management Trainee
NNG is on an ambitious journey to redefine the customer experience in automotive through digital technology, and some of the most exciting activities are happening in Product Management.

NNG invites applications for the position Product/Project Management Trainee for the Business Management organization. This Trainee will join NNG’s growing Product Management team and help realize its vision.

The ideal candidate possesses a fervent enthusiasm for people, products, and technology. You will play a crucial role in orchestrating the global launch of NNG's connected automotive products across automotive B2B and B2C channels. An exemplary applicant for this role demonstrates a deep-seated commitment to user needs, a profound grasp of technology, and an adeptness in dissecting intricate problem spaces into actionable steps that facilitate the creation of impactful products. In this capacity, you will forge cross-functional collaborations, shepherding products from conception to launch by bridging the realms of technology and business.
Tasks
• Collaborate with Product Managers to fathom user personas and pain points.
• Join forces with Product Managers to fashion feature lists, user stories, and roadmaps.
• Join forces with Product Marketing team, contribute to the creation of materials to communicate progress to partners, clients, and executive management.
• Collect and oversee product feedback.
• Monitor and report on product KPIs.
• Contribute to the formulation of business cases and operational strategies.
• Take part in coordination of events, benchmarking activities, device handling
Expectations
• Presently enrolled in a Bachelor's or Master's degree program.
• Pursuing a degree in Business Administration, Management, Computer Science, or related field.
• Demonstrates professional fluency in written and spoken English.
• Thrives in high-pressure, fast-paced environments.
• Available to dedicate a minimum of 20 hours per week, with the potential for up to 40 hours.
• Prior experience or knowledge in Project Management; previous work experience preferred.
• Proficiency with tools such as Jira, Confluence, and Aha! would be highly advantageous.
